    About Navy Chaplains

    The Navy Chaplain Corps comprises over 800 Navy Chaplains from more than 100 faith groups, including Christian, Jewish, Muslim, Buddhist, and many others.

    Each Chaplain is a Navy Officer, holding an important leadership role.

    Chaplains provide support, guidance, and solace to those in need, adhering to the guiding principles of the Chaplain Mission:

    • Providing religious ministry and support to those of your own faith
    • Facilitating the religious requirements of those from all faiths
    • Caring for all servicemembers and their families, including those subscribing to no specific faith
    • Advising the command in ensuring the free exercise of religion

    Responsibilities

    As a Navy Chaplain, your duties span various tasks:

    • Conducting worship services in different settings
    • Performing religious rites and ceremonies, such as weddings, funeral services, and baptisms
    • Counseling individuals seeking guidance
    • Overseeing religious education programs, including Sunday school and youth groups
    • Visiting and providing spiritual guidance and care to hospitalized personnel and/or their family members
    • Training lay leaders who conduct religious education programs
    • Promoting attendance at religious services, retreats, and conferences
    • Advising leaders at all levels regarding morale, ethics, and spiritual well-being

    Work Environment

    Navy Chaplains immerse themselves in the daily lives of servicemembers, offering guidance and insight whenever needed.

    You may provide support while on land or at sea, presiding over religious ceremonies on a base or conducting services from the flight deck of an aircraft carrier.

    Training and Advancement

    To become a Navy Chaplain, you are required to attend Officer Development School and complete a seven-week course at the Naval Chaplaincy School and Center.

    Promotion opportunities are regularly available but competitive and based on performance.

    Specialized training and work experience can lead to valuable credentialing and occupational opportunities in related fields like family counseling and behavioral therapy.

    Education Opportunities

    Navy Chaplains typically continue their education throughout their careers.

    Opportunities for continuing education are available through the Advanced Education Program, allowing you to pursue higher education while serving as a Navy Officer.

    You can also advance your education by:

    • Pursuing opportunities at institutions like the Naval Postgraduate School (NPS)
    • Completing Joint Professional Military Education (JPME) at one of the service colleges

    Qualifications and Requirements

    To serve as a Navy Chaplain and Officer, you must meet the following qualifications:

    • Hold a bachelor's degree from a qualified four-year undergraduate educational institution
    • Have a graduate degree in theological or related studies from an accredited educational institution
    • Have two years of full-time religious leadership experience compatible with the duties of a Religious Ministry Professional (RMP)
    • Be able to obtain an Ecclesiastical Endorsement from a registered religious faith organization with the Department of Defense
